Mazda ATENZA
29,061 registered in New Zealand · 2002–2023 · 100% from Japan
The Mazda ATENZA is a well-established model on New Zealand roads, with 29,061 registered across model years 2002 to 2023. It averages 7.5 L/100km in fuel consumption . Most are petrol-powered station wagons with a 2.3L engine.

How many Mazda ATENZA are there in New Zealand?
There are 29,061 Mazda ATENZA vehicles registered in New Zealand as of March 2026, making up 0.8% of the total passenger fleet. Model years range from 2002 to 2023. A large fleet means parts are widely available and mechanics are familiar with this model.
How much does it cost to run a Mazda ATENZA?
Based on NZTA fuel economy data, the Mazda ATENZA averages 7.5 L/100km. At current fuel prices ($3.41/L), that works out to roughly $59 per week or $3,069 per year in fuel, assuming 12,000 km of annual driving. Actual costs vary by model year, driving conditions, and fuel type.
What body type is the Mazda ATENZA?
The Mazda ATENZA is primarily classified as a station wagon in the NZTA fleet register. It is also available in other body configurations: saloon, hatchback, sports car. The most common fuel type is petrol.
Are Mazda ATENZA cars imported or NZ-new?
100% of Mazda ATENZA vehicles in New Zealand originated from Japan. The majority arrived as used imports, which is typical for this model. Check the import status and origin country for the specific year you're considering on the individual year pages.
